Doing the prep work on ANYTHING will lower the price. If you go sand the whole car down, do your own bondo, initial sanding, primer, then mask off the whole car yourself, even a Maaco paint job ($200ish) will look decent. But you still get what you pay for. Expect to pay $1000+ for a really acceptable whole car paint job. If you are just gonna get parts touched up, they'll do it for much cheaper but the new paint might not match the old paint perfectly.

the paint shade slightly changes over the years from weathering or different chemicals in the paint and from what they use now. sometimes its close and most people wont see a difference but other times its obviously not the same color! its best to get the whole car done... otherwise just get some touch up paint and dab in where you need it just to keep it from rusting further.

but if you go with the cheap macoo paint job im sure the paint wont match and youll want the whole car done!
